Logo DesignThe logo is arguably the most powerful piece of design. It should be simple, direct and immediate. However, it is at the same time one of the most challenging and complicated pieces of design to effectively construct. Students will be challenged to create a logo redesign for the company of their choice. This redesign should be based on a thoroughly documented process of research and sketching. Research should focus on the intended audience for the company/product and logos and designs from similar companies. Students are reminded to keep it simple and to showcase their understanding of mass, shape, space and line.
Students will be expected to demonstrate how well they understand Adobe Illustrator tools and techniques when creating vector imagery from scratch based on their own sketches and drawings.
